DESCRIPTION

This is a 3D low-poly model of a mudskipper, a unique amphibious fish known for its ability to thrive both in water and on land. The model captures its distinctive features, including a cylindrical body, prominent eyes, and strong pectoral fins adapted for movement on muddy terrain. Ideal for educational or nature-themed projects, this low-poly representation balances simplicity with key biological details.
